Continue to develop elegant and rock-solid systems using PHP. With a focus on mastering essential development tools and applying best practices, Volume 2 of this 7th edition has been fully updated for PHP 8.3 and the most recent stable iterations of all tools and processes. It includes entirely new chapters covering Docker, Ansible, refactoring tools, and PHP on the command line. The volume also reintroduces a chapter on inline documentation and extends its coverage of continuous integration to include GitHub Actions. This book builds on the solid grounding provided by Volume 1 to cover the tools and practices needed to develop, test, and deploy robust code. You’ll see how to manage multiple developers and releases with git, create development environments, and deploy Composer to leverage thousands of tools and libraries and manage dependencies. You’ll also explore strategies for automated testing and continuous integration and learn essential techniques for deploying your code using Git and Ansible. After reading and using this book, you will have mastered a toolset that can support the entire lifecycle of a PHP project, from the creation of a flexible development environment, through collaboration, the use of standards-based best practice and documentation, to testing and deployment across multiple production servers. You Will Learn To: Master the tools and strategies for testing new code, and techniques for testing legacy projects Create inline documentation for use by team members, users, and tools such as IDEs Work with Selenium to test web interfaces Manage your code and collaborate with your team using Git Leverage continuous integration to build rock solid systems Deploy your system and securely manage your project’s configuration with Ansible Who This Book Is For Anyone with at least a basic knowledge of PHP who wants to learn about the practices and tools) that can make projects safe, elegant and stable.
